Trade-in strategies in retail channel and dual-channel closed-loop supply chain with remanufacturing
Lu Xiao,
Xian-Jia Wang and
Kwai-Sang Chin
Transportation Research Part E: Logistics and Transportation Review, 2020, vol. 136, issue C
Abstract:
To derive conditions for manufacturer and retailer to implement trade-in policies voluntarily and identify the optimal channel format for trade-in, we construct traditional retail channel model and dual-channel model under two scenarios: without trade-in and with trade-in. We find that the retailer would implement trade-in policy voluntarily in traditional retail channel only if old customers’ market share exceeds a certain threshold. Interestingly, the result is opposite in dual-channel case. The traditional retail channel and the dual-channel could be the optimal choice for implementing trade-in respectively, depending on different value ranges of customers’ acceptance of direct online channel.
